            On Saturday, October 17, members and non-members got their sweat on for a good cause at the first annual nationwide Crunch-a-thon event to raise funds for Augie’s Quest and finding a cure for ALS (Lou Gehrig’s disease). Crunch offered a day of non-stop group fitness classes and personal training sessions at every Crunch location nationwide, with all proceeds going to Augie’s Quest.

            Augie’s Quest was founded by fitness pioneer and founder of Life Fitness, Augie Nieto. Augie was diagnosed with ALS in March 2005, and since, has made it his personal mission to find a cure for the terminal disease by partnering with the Muscular Dystrophy Association (MDA) to create Augie’s Quest. Augie has also called upon his friends and colleagues in the fitness industry, by creating Clubs for a Cure.  Since their inception, Augie’s Quest and Clubs for a Cure have raised over $19,000,000.

            Crunch kicked off their fundraising efforts prior to October 17, with in-club initiatives, by displaying the names of members who have donated on the community board, offering new members the opportunity to support Augie’s Quest with a donation added on to their initiation fee, and encouraging an additional dollar donation on retail and juice bar purchases.

            The Crunch-a-thon raised a grand total of $30,194.50 making Crunch the top fundraising gym chain of its size! Crunch is grateful to all those that participated and donated for this great cause.
